Pear Tree Pruning Questions
Why is pear tree pruning important? Proper pruning helps maintain tree health, encourages fruit production, and prevents branches from becoming too heavy or damaged.
When is the best time to prune a pear tree? The ideal time is during late winter or early spring when the tree is dormant, before new growth begins.
What pruning techniques are used for pear trees? Techniques include removing dead or diseased branches, thinning out crowded areas, and shaping the canopy for better air circulation.
Can pruning improve fruit yield on a pear tree? Yes, strategic pruning can increase fruit size and quality by allowing more sunlight and air to reach the fruit-bearing branches.
